What You’ll Do
- Facilitate and deliver applied agriculture and agricultural technology programs to offenders.
- Implement departmental education policies and curriculum requirements within correctional facilities.
- Present learning programs in accordance with approved educational standards.
- Provide learners with both theoretical knowledge and practical skills in agriculture.
- Assess student progress using appropriate evaluation methods and maintain accurate academic records.
- Create a conducive learning environment that supports effective teaching and personal development among offenders.
- Ensure compliance with established education and training service standards.
What You’ll Need
- A recognised four-year degree or equivalent qualification in Education, specialising in Applied Agriculture & Agricultural Technology and IsiXhosa.
- Registration with the South African Council of Educators.
- Proficiency in computer literacy.
- A valid driver’s licence.
- Strong competencies in planning, organising, and leading educational initiatives.
- Excellent communication and report-writing skills.
- Knowledge of public service management frameworks and effective conflict management skills.
